Writer is an AI writing tool that helps teams write in the same tone and style so that all of the company’s communications are consistent and representative of the brand. May started Writer in 2020.

Paymo is a work management platform for small and medium-sized businesses that has served over 150,000 users worldwide since launching in 2008, offering a wide range of efficiency tools that help teams work smarter, faster, and on budget.
